Climate twins of Alva, OK

These are the US cities whose 12-month climate pattern most closely matches Alva's. Each "twin" must be at least 140 miles away to avoid trivial near-neighbor matches. Similarity is computed across all 24 monthly metrics (12 average temperatures + 12 average precipitations), normalized so temperature and precipitation contribute equally.

Side-by-side: Alva vs its climate twin

Top match: Solomon, KS

Month Alva Solomon
High Low Precip High Low Precip
January 47.0°F 22.7°F 0.99 in 43.2°F 21.7°F 0.86 in
February 51.5°F 26.0°F 1.22 in 48.6°F 25.2°F 1.43 in
March 61.1°F 34.5°F 2.44 in 59.7°F 34.9°F 2.23 in
April 70.7°F 43.7°F 2.93 in 69.7°F 44.7°F 3.26 in
May 80.0°F 55.8°F 4.05 in 78.9°F 54.7°F 5.20 in
June 89.9°F 65.9°F 4.51 in 89.4°F 64.8°F 4.18 in
July 95.2°F 70.5°F 3.31 in 94.4°F 69.4°F 4.75 in
August 92.6°F 68.2°F 3.60 in 92.1°F 67.4°F 4.27 in
September 86.1°F 59.7°F 2.02 in 84.2°F 58.9°F 2.54 in
October 72.8°F 46.0°F 2.45 in 71.2°F 46.4°F 2.47 in
November 59.1°F 34.3°F 1.49 in 57.1°F 34.1°F 1.59 in
December 47.7°F 25.1°F 1.31 in 45.4°F 24.5°F 1.50 in

How this is computed

Each city is represented by a 24-dimensional vector: 12 monthly average temperatures and 12 monthly average precipitations. Each dimension is z-score normalized across the population of US cities, so that temperature variance and precipitation variance contribute proportionally. Distance between cities is Euclidean.
